Near Fine book with slight crimping to spine ends and very mild splay to front board; in a Near Fine jacket with slight edge and corner wear and a touch of rubbing. Hillenbrand's very long-running best-selling account of the life of Olympic runner Louis Zamperini. The 2014 movie based partly on the book, was directed and produced by Jolie Angelina received mixed reviews, partly because significant parts of book were not covered in the film.
